This CD20/Side Scatter dot plot is gated on CD45+ events. Unlike the dot plots gated on Lymphocytes, it includes the named populations defined on the CD45/Side Scatter dot plot: lymphocytes (red), monocytes (green), granulocytes (blue), and blasts (pink). A portion of the blasts (pink) express CD20.

ThisCD56/CD19dot plot isgatedonCD45+events. Unlike thedot plots gated on Lymphocytes, it includes the named populations defined on the CD45/Side Scatter dot plot: lymphocytes (red), monocytes (green), granulocytes (blue), and blasts (pink). The blasts (pink) are negative for CD56 and positive for CD19.

ThisCD34/CD10dot plot isgatedonCD45+events. Unlike thedot plots gated on Lymphocytes, it includes the named populations defined on the CD45/Side Scatter dot plot: lymphocytes (red), monocytes (green), granulocytes (blue), and blasts (pink). As noted elsewhere in the analysis, the blasts (pink) express CD10 and partial CD34.

This CD34/CD20 dot plot is gated on CD45+ events. Unlike the dot plots gated on Lymphocytes, it includes the named populations defined on the CD45/Side Scatter dot plot: lymphocytes (red), monocytes (green), granulocytes (blue), and blasts (pink). As noted elsewhere the blasts (pink) express CD34 and partial CD20.
